Understanding Digital Nomad Jobs

Digital nomads have the freedom to choose from various job formats that suit their lifestyle and work preferences. Here are the main types of digital nomad jobs:

1. Freelance Jobs

Freelancing is a popular choice among digital nomads. As a freelancer, you work on a project basis for different clients, offering your skills and expertise in areas such as writing, graphic design, web development, or marketing.

  • Flexibility: Freelancers have the flexibility to choose when and where they work, making it easier to travel and explore new destinations.
  • Income Stability: Income can vary greatly depending on the number of clients and projects you take on. It’s important to have a steady stream of work to maintain financial stability.
  • Commitment Levels: Freelancers have the freedom to decide how much time and effort they want to invest in each project. However, meeting client deadlines is crucial for maintaining a good reputation.

2. Contract Work

Contract work involves working for a specific company or organization for a fixed period of time. This could be in the form of short-term contracts or long-term agreements.

  • Flexibility: While contract work offers some flexibility, it may not be as flexible as freelancing since you’ll need to adhere to the terms of the contract.
  • Income Stability: Contract work often provides more stable income compared to freelancing, as you’ll have a guaranteed payment for the duration of the contract.
  • Commitment Levels: Depending on the contract terms, you may need to commit a certain number of hours or days per week to fulfill your responsibilities.

3. Remote Employment

Remote employment refers to full-time or part-time positions where you work for a company but are not required to be physically present in the office. This allows you to work from anywhere in the world.

  • Flexibility: Remote employment offers flexibility in terms of location, but you may still have set working hours depending on your employer’s requirements.
  • Income Stability: Remote employees typically receive a regular salary, providing more stability compared to freelance or contract work.
  • Commitment Levels: As a remote employee, you’ll need to commit to your job responsibilities and deliver results as per your employer’s expectations.

4. Entrepreneurial Ventures

Some digital nomads choose to start their own businesses or ventures while traveling. This could involve running an online store, offering consulting services, or creating digital products.

  • Flexibility: Entrepreneurial ventures offer the most flexibility since you’re your own boss and can set your own schedule.
  • Income Stability: Income can be unpredictable in the early stages of entrepreneurship, but with successful ventures, it has the potential to surpass traditional job earnings.
  • Commitment Levels: Starting and running a business requires significant time and effort commitment, especially during the initial stages.

Understanding these different job formats will help you determine which type of digital nomad job aligns with your skills, preferences, and lifestyle goals.

Where to Find Legit Remote Work Opportunities

Finding legitimate remote work requires navigating numerous platforms, many of which cater specifically to digital nomads. The best remote job platforms combine reliability, verified listings, and diverse opportunities suited for various skill levels and industries.

Key platforms trusted by digital nomads include:

  • FlexJobs: A highly curated site offering vetted remote and flexible jobs across multiple industries. Known for its strict screening process, FlexJobs reduces the risk of scams commonly found on free boards. Categories range from marketing and project management to customer service and IT.
  • Dynamite Jobs: Focused exclusively on remote positions, Dynamite Jobs updates frequently with roles in tech, writing, design, and more. Its straightforward interface allows filtering by job type and commitment level, catering well to nomads seeking stable contract or full-time remote employment.
  • Remote OK: A popular hub for tech-related roles like web development, programming, and design. Remote OK features global listings from startups to established companies actively hiring remote talent. The platform’s transparency about company details helps verify job authenticity.
  • We Work Remotely: Specializes in remote jobs in programming, marketing, customer support, and sales. It has a strong community reputation for genuine job postings and serves as a go-to for experienced professionals.
  • AngelList: Tailored for startups offering remote roles in product development, engineering, and business development. Digital nomads interested in entrepreneurial environments find valuable opportunities here.

Choosing platforms with rigorous verification processes is critical to avoid scams that plague many generic job boards. These targeted sites provide tools such as company reviews, salary insights, and clear job descriptions that enhance trustworthiness. Alternative Avenues for Finding Remote Jobs

Digital nomads can expand their job search beyond dedicated remote work platforms by utilizing freelancing platforms. Marketplaces such as Upwork and Fiverr enable professionals to showcase diverse skills while engaging with a wide variety of short-term and long-term projects. These platforms support building a client base gradually, offering opportunities to refine service offerings and receive feedback that boosts credibility.

Key advantages of freelancing marketplaces include:

  • Access to global clients across industries
  • Flexibility to select projects aligning with personal expertise and schedule
  • Potential to scale from small gigs to ongoing contracts

Networking plays a critical role in uncovering remote work prospects often absent from public listings. Establishing connections with friends or acquaintances who operate online businesses can open doors to referrals or collaborative ventures. Digital nomad communities—whether local meetups or online forums—serve as valuable resources for sharing job leads, advice, and support. Engaging actively in these groups fosters relationships that may lead to hidden opportunities tailored specifically for nomadic lifestyles.

Strategies for effective networking:

  1. Join Facebook groups or Slack channels focused on digital nomads
  2. Attend virtual or in-person coworking events and workshops
  3. Participate in industry-specific online communities such as GitHub or Behance

Combining freelancing platforms with targeted networking enhances the likelihood of securing legitimate remote roles suited to individual skills and preferences.

Special Considerations for Digital Nomads in Spain

Spain has introduced a digital nomad visa to cater to the growing trend of remote work. This visa allows individuals to reside in Spain while working for foreign companies or as freelancers without the need for a traditional work permit. Here are some key points to consider regarding the digital nomad visa in Spain:

1. Eligibility Criteria

  • Applicants must demonstrate sufficient income to support themselves.
  • They should not engage in any local employment in Spain.

2. Application Process

  • Submitting necessary documents such as proof of income, health insurance, and a clean criminal record.
  • Providing a detailed plan outlining their remote work activities while in Spain.

3. Benefits

  • Legal authorization to live and work remotely in Spain.
  • Access to Spain’s healthcare and other public services.

4. Duration and Renewal

  • The initial visa is typically valid for a year and can be renewed annually.
  • After residing in Spain for five years, individuals may be eligible to apply for permanent residency.

This digital nomad visa opens up opportunities for English-speaking expats and nomads looking to experience the vibrant culture and lifestyle of Spain while continuing their remote work endeavors. Tips for Successfully Securing Legit Remote Work

Importance of Patience and Methodical Job Search Strategies

  • Avoid rushing into job offers; take the time to research and assess each opportunity thoroughly.
  • Develop a systematic approach to your job search, setting realistic goals and timelines for applications.

Verifying Authenticity of Job Postings

  • Research companies before applying to ensure they are reputable and legitimate.
  • Look for red flags like requests for payment or personal information upfront.

Building Skills Aligned with High-Demand Roles

  • Identify key skills in demand for remote work, such as programming languages or SEO expertise.
  • Invest time in upskilling or gaining certifications that align with these high-demand roles.

By following these tips, digital nomads can navigate the remote job market effectively, increasing their chances of securing legitimate and rewarding opportunities.
